California's Attorney General has ideas to boost mobile app privacy

0. phoneArena posted on 10 Jan 2013, 18:41

California Attorney General Kamala Harris has come up with some ideas on how to discover what information mobile apps are obtaining about you, how that information is acquired, and what third parties are receiving this information; her report entitled ""Privacy on the Go: Recommendations for the Mobile Ecosystem," suggests using notifications to let people know how personal information is being shared and used...
